About Our Practice

Our mission is to provide compassionate, world-class care to the most vulnerable babies while supporting families throughout their child’s hospital stay. Our multidisciplinary team is equipped to provide comprehensive care for seriously ill newborns and address complications of prematurity and other issues, such as respiratory, craniofacial, endocrine and gastroenterological conditions. We strive to provide comprehensive, evidence-based care with an emphasis on open communication to ensure our tiniest patients and their families feel cared for and nurtured.

High-RIsk Follow-Up

Our high-risk follow-up clinic aims to provide quality, family-centered care to our patients. Our clinic comprises neonatologists, pediatricians, nurse practitioners, dieticians and therapists whose goal is to identify developmental, nutritional and related health problems early to assist in and improve the long-term outcomes and medical care of high-risk infants. We are committed to providing care consistent with the best clinical practices and supportive of each child’s medical home. Through education and collaboration with other members of the community, we serve as advocates for children who either have or may be at risk for developing special health care needs.
